Job summary

Toromont Cat in Vaughan, Canada seeks an Applications Specialist to join our team. This full-time, permanent role focuses on heavy equipment and customer site applications, assisting sales and service teams with technical guidance.

You will partner with Caterpillar and internal groups to optimize go-to-market strategies across Eastern Canada, while supporting training and product updates. A strong customer focus and safety mindset are essential for success in this role.

About Toromont Cat

With over 4,000 employees and 56 locations from Manitoba to Newfoundland, Toromont Cat has a proven track record, industry knowledge, dealership infrastructure, and service mindset to ensure our Construction, Mining, and Power Generation customers succeed. At Toromont Cat, work is built around people's strengths, our products, technology and an outstanding customer experience and through our strong partnership with Caterpillar ™,Toromont Cat takes care of our employees who take care of our customers!
